depop is how I get my spending money, since I use the money from my real job to pay bills and deposit the rest into savings. I actually make a killing selling handmade normie accessories
as far as Jfash goes, try searching using whatever brand you want + "egl" and it'll reduce tag spam. normies know what "lolita" is but not egl. and if you're searching for baby deffo use "btssb" instead of typing out the full name or else you'll get fetish shit. I've had good luck with blouses and one brand jsk for under $90 in fantastic condition! I think everyone skipped over it because the photos were shit

Poshmark is WAY worse than Depop. Poshmark has more lowballers and tag spammers, is populated with entitled Karens (their target market), and UI is complete garbage to boot. The selling fee is also double Depop's fee.
I tried selling on Posh years before Depop became popular and it was hell. Posh has a return policy where they can return an item for any reason as long as Posh deems it reasonable, so I've had shit like earrings and keychains returned for "incorrect size listed" and Posh would always side with the buyer. Also, Posh holds onto your money and you have to manually send in a request to cash out your earnings instead of it being automatically sent to your PayPal like on Depop.

Interestingly, Secret Honey's Disney collab dresses sell EXTREMELY well on Posh due to all of the Disney-obsessed wine moms on the platform. You can overcharge like hell and it will sell quickly anyways. I've seen the Secret Honey Rapunzel dress go for $600+.

I use it to sell J-fashion and decluttering my normie wardrobe. I wouldn't sell Lolita there.

Pros:
-personal suggestions, your item can be suggested to others that might want to buy it, even when you dont use tags! So Im guessing the algorithm is pretty smart.
-Lots of traffic
-Ease of payment (no sending invoice, no waiting for payment since you have to pay to checkout)
-I actually enjoy the IG-like way it looks, and its nice to see the creativity of sellers
-You find really cheap stuff sometimes!!
-You help the environment and other humans / small businesses!

Cons:
-Fees are horrible, 10% of your transaction, INCLUDING SHIPPING FOR SOME REASON???
- People message you to ask for discounts a lot.
-I hate the 10% fee
- The app glitches a lot.
